Recall history

1 distinct campaigns affect this selection. Announcement dates below are different from vehicle model years. A campaign may cover multiple years.

77V002000 ยท Equipment:Recreational Vehicle/Trailer:Lpg Systems

Reported: 1977-01-04 (January 4, 1977)

THE FURNACE ON THE INVOLVED VEHICLES MAY HAVE BEEN IMPROPERLY INSTALLED. CONSEQUENTLY, WHEN THE FURNACE IS IN SERVICE, A DOWN DRAFT OR SUCTION MAY BE CREATED WITHIN THE REFRIGERATOR CABINET. FURTHERMORE, THIS DOWN DRAFT COULD CAUSE THE FLAME TO BE DRAWN DOWN OVER THE TOP OF THE BURNER.

Remedy: THE DEALER WILL INSTALL VENEER PANELS OVER AN ACCESS OPENING AT THE BOTTOM OF THE REFRIGERATOR CABINET TO ELIMINATE THE DOWN DRAFT. THIS WILL BE PERFORMED FREE OF CHARGE.
